f(x) = coses x in (-π, 0) has a maxima atA. x = 0B. x = -π/4C. x = -π/3D. x = -π/2

Answer»

Answer is : D. x = -π/2

We can go through options for this question

Option a is wrong because 0 is not included in (-π,0)

At x = -π/4 value of f(x) is -√2 = -1.41

At x = -π/3 value of f(x) is -2.

At x = -π/2 value of f(x) is -1.

∴ f(x) has max value at x = -π/2.

Which is -1.
